Orlando Museum of Art hosting 'Low Vision Day'
video

Today, the Orlando Museum of Art (OMA) is partnering with eSight by Gentex to host ?Low Vision Day." This event will offer free museum access and the use of wearable low-vision technology to help visitors with central vision loss experience art without limitations. The event is inspired by artist Kelly Joy Ladd, who lost part of her vision following a traumatic brain injury. In a moving full-circle moment, she now returns to OMA not as a visitor, but as one of the featured artists in this year?s Florida Prize in Contemporary Art exhibition. New library coming to Maitland
video

Maitland city leaders have approved the final plans for a new two-story public library and upgrades to Quinn Strong Park, marking a major milestone for a project years in the making. Maitland's original library was built in 1907. Stacie Larson, director of the Maitland library, joins Good Day Orlando to discuss the $16 million project.

Protecting yourself from flesh-eating bacteria
video

It's summer, which means more people are enjoying time in the water to ward off the brutal heat in Florida. Fresh water can carry some risks with it, including flesh-eating bacteria. The Vibrio vulnificus bacteria, found in saltwater, brackish water and inside raw or undercooked seafood, led to deaths in Bay, Broward, Hillsborough and St. Johns counties, according to the Florida Department of Health (FDOH). Orlando Health's Dr. Daniel Egan joins Good Day Orlando to talk about the bacteria and how to keep yourself safe.
